The Design of the Wall Made It a Strong Defense System. The average height of the Great Wall is 7.8 meters but it reaches about 14 meters in some sections. The width of the wall is about 4 to 5 meters. Its height and width make it very solid and this prevented any enemies from intruding. Most sections of the Great Wall were built on mountain ...

The First Great Wall was ordered built in 214 BC by Qin Shi Huang Di after he had finished consolidating his rule and creating a unified China for the first time. The wall was designed to stop raids by the nomadic Xiongnu raiders from the north. 500,000 laborers were used during the 32-year building period to create the First Great Wall.

The history of the Great Wall of China began when fortifications built by various states during the Spring and Autumn (771–476 BC) [1] and Warring States periods (475–221 BC) were connected by the first emperor of China, Qin Shi Huang, to protect his newly founded Qin dynasty (221–206 BC) against incursions by nomads from Inner Asia. China Walls is the nickname for a coastal cliffside attraction that is made notable by rock platforms that jut out to the ocean on the east side of Oahu, in Hawaii Kai. The stretch of lava-rock ledges attract daring cliff jumpers, while seasonal swell draws surfers as well. There is also a gathering of those who simply come to lay a towel down ...

The Xi'an City Wall is on the tentative list of UNESCO's World Heritage Site under the title "City Walls of the Ming and Qing Dynasties". Since 2008, it is also on the list of the State Administration of Cultural Heritage of the People's Republic of China. Since March 1961, the Xi'an City Wall is a heritage National Historical and Cultural Unit.10. It is Chinese people's greatest cultural icon. Then, use a brown crayon to color the battlements on top of the towers ...The construction of the Huanghuacheng Great Wall lasted 188 years, from 1404 to 1592. It was built to protect emperors - Alive and Dead!. To enhance the defense of the northern border, the emperors of the Ming Dynasty (1368–1644) built an outer Great Wall and an inner Great Wall. Located on the southeastern coast of Oahu, Hawaii, the China Walls is an impressive natural formation attracting adventure seekers from across the world. Its unique flat-topped volcanic rock formations, which resemble a wall, extend into the sea, creating a natural stage for daring divers and surfers.
